Giving back to a seriously worthy charity while at the same time getting something sweet in return is a win-win. Minuteman Watches are crafted right in the good ole US of A, and a portion of the sales will go to benefit disabled vets (as in veterans, not the people who treat your sick dog, though they deserve recognition too). Each watch measures 43mm, includes two NATO-style straps in black and olive green, and is built by LUM-TEC in Ohio. The watches are water resistant up to 200m, feature a Swiss Ronda caliber 715LI quartz movement, and have a badass military appeal to honor those who served. Definitely something to get behind.
